Free-spirited black sheep, Taz Boran, has worked tirelessly as a nurse bringing efficient medical care to Africa for the past eight years. But when her sister Nicky is told she doesn't have long to live, she immediately flies home to small-town Eminence, Missouri. Unfortunately, taking care of Nicky means being around her husband, Rafe; the one man Taz could never forget. Rafe is not only her brother-in-law but also took over the family veterinary clinic from her dad. As Taz becomes Nicky's home health care nurse—working closely with Rafe to make her sister comfortable—their latent attraction comes sizzling back to the surface. They won’t betray Nicky, but if her dying wish is to see them get the happy ending they always deserved, can they really keep fighting what’s meant to be?

I felt soo torn many times with this story, I loved everyone but at times felt like Taz and Rafe stepped over a line or it was too soon, then there was Taz and Nicky's mom who I just wanted to shake and make her see her judgment is a main reason for Taz staying away and everyone's relationship is so broken and then I also want to gather everyone is a big hug and wish it was all better. This is definitely an emotional rollercoaster ride of emotions that has you pulled in different directions as you see the family having to deal with a devastating loss and how they pick up the pieces afterwards and how they must deal with the past if any of them are to move forward. Be ready for anger, sadness, heartbreak, hope, self doubt and the chance at happiness and the wish that everyone could be happy again.
